Challenges of utilising sensor data acquired by smart products in product development activities
Emerging digital technologies enable capturing of product’s digital footprint through continuous monitoring of its performance, usage, and working environment while using data acquired by its embedded sensors. However, it seems that product development (PD) teams within engineering companies have not yet embraced the usage of sensor data acquired by smart products (SPs) when conducting PD activities. The presented study discusses several challenges that hinder a broader utilisation of SP's sensor data within PD. In addition to the literature review, the discussion is supported with empirical data gathered through a qualitative exploratory case study conducted in a large engineering and manufacturing company. As a result, three challenges are outlined. Firstly, it is challenging for the company's management and PD team to gain transparency over the benefits of sensor data utilisation for PD. Secondly, solutions providing accessibility and visualisation of gathered data should be tailored to the PD activities and teams, which requires a holistic understanding. Finally, it is suggested that new skills, roles, and processes should be introduced to enable SP's sensor data utilisation within PD activities.
